Data We Collect & What We Delete
The App does not require accounts or track users extensively. Data collected includes:
- Device Information: Device type, OS version, unique identifiers. These are deleted upon request; anonymous aggregates may be retained indefinitely for analytics but are fully disassociated from your identity.
- Usage Data: Anonymous app interactions not tied to individuals. These are kept indefinitely but disassociated from any personal identifiers.
- Contact Information: Details from support emails, including your name and email address. These are fully deleted upon request.
- Community Data: Any posts, comments, or profile data if you use community features. Fully deleted upon request.
Upon a deletion request, we remove all identifiable personal data within 30 days, including from backups.

What Happens After Your Request
- Verification: We confirm your identity using the details you provide (e.g., matching your support email).
- Deletion: Personal data is removed from servers and backups within 30 days. You will receive email confirmation when complete.
- Retention: Only non-identifiable aggregates are kept (e.g., anonymized crash statistics). No recovery is possible after deletion.
- Exceptions: Legal holds may delay deletion in rare circumstances. You will be notified if this applies to your request.
